The Welsh Corgi is a canine breed that has actually won the hearts of people around the world with its kindness, activity and unique look. There are 2 primary kinds of corgi: Pembroke and Cardigan, Read Full Article each of which has its very own characteristics. Known for their endurance and knowledge, these little yet solid canines have become especially popular thanks to the British royal family members, who have actually maintained corgis for years.


There are tales that corgis were a present from the woodland elves, and their visible areas on the fur are saddles for fairy motorcyclists. Clinically, it is thought that the type originated from Scandinavian pets that arrived in Wales with the Vikings. Corgis were made use of as rounding up canines to aid herd livestock, thanks to their capacity to navigate swiftly and bark noisally.

Their little size allowed them to avoid being hit by the hooves of huge cattle, and their dexterity and endurance made them essential aides on the farm. Over time, thanks to their lovely character and appearance, corgis have come to be preferred as family pets. Welsh Corgis are divided right into two major kinds: Pembroke Welsh Corgi and Cardigan Welsh Corgi.


The Pembroke is the extra prominent and identifiable type of corgi, many thanks partly to Her Majesty Queen Elizabeth II, that kept these dogs throughout her life. Pembrokes have a much shorter tail that is occasionally clipped, although this method is becoming much less prominent and is banned in some nations. Their coat is normally much shorter and thicker, and the shade can be red, sable, tricolor or black with red markings.


They have a longer tail and even more varied coat colors, including grey, red, sable, black with red markings, and blue merle (light grey with black markings). Cardigans are also much heavier and have larger bones, which makes them a little bit bigger in size.

Welsh Corgis are understood for their friendly and friendly nature, that makes them wonderful buddies for households with children. They love to play and hang out with their relative, consisting of little children. It is essential to bear in mind that corgis are herding dogs, so they might naturally attempt to "herd" kids by easily attacking their legs.


Corgis usually hit it off with various other animals, specifically if they have expanded up with each other. Nevertheless, their herding reactions can lead them to chase smaller sized pets, so it's important to see their interactions. Early training is necessary for Corgis to teach them exactly how to connect appropriately with youngsters and various other animals.
